Abstract
A display system architecture which has rectangular area filling as its primitive operation is presented. It is shown that lines can be drawn significantly faster with this architecture than with a pixel display system. The rendition of filled boxes is also faster showing an O(n^2) speed improvement. Furthermore filled polygons can be rendered with an O(n) speed improvement. The design and implementation of this rectangular area filling architecture are discussed and refined. A custom VLSI integrated circuit is currently being designed to implement this rectangular area filling architecture and at the same time reduce the display memory system video refresh bandwidth requirements.
